Chinese villager's fiery tribute at ancestor's grave causes deadly forest blaze

Footage of a fire raging in a forest in northern China after a local villager reportedly burnt paper as part of a tribute to a dead ancestor.
The video, captured in Jinzhong, Shanxi Province, shows a mountain engulfed in flames with thick smoke rising into the sky.
According to local reports, the blaze started on Monday when the villager was paying respects at a grave.
Four firefighters died tackling the flames but the fire has now been extinguished.
